Webb18 nov. 2024 · Ostinatos are usually repeated rhythmic patterns that have a certain number of beats. Ostinatos can be as short as one beat or as long as hundreds of measures. Ostinato patterns with longer durations tend to give a sense of stability and motion, while those with shorter durations tend to create tension and provide contrast. Webb9 dec. 2016 · Ragtime music originated on the piano. They music is fast and syncopated (“ragged”), with the right hand doing all the crazy rhythms and the left hand played steadily. In ragtime, the left hand usually plays a bass note on beat 1 and 3, with a chord on beat 2 and 4. Ragtime harmonic patterns are fairly simple, doing a lot of tonic-dominant ...
